Ok, so I have a highmounted stoplight in a 76 clubman. I've noticed the LED brake light comes on fine with the parkers and headlights off, however it doesn't work with any of the lights on. This is less than ideal, unless I restrict myself to daytime use only, or make sure no one is behind me at night (its only a 998 so prob not going to happen). Anyway, the normal globe brake lights still work fine with parkers/headlights on or off and electrics are otherwise fine (as far as I can tell). No other mods to the car. check the earth for the high mount stoplight. Chances are it's earthing through the stop light circuit, so works when the lights are off, but won't work when the lights are on |

Cheers for that! You were bang on the money. I traced the wiring down and ended up having to remove the tank to fix the issue. It was earthing through the parking light circuit just behind the LHS tail-lamp assembly. Also fixed the breather hose that was getting squeezed shut by the tank strap while I was there ![]() |

no worries... it's very common on modern cars too as their wiring and connection deteriorates. I often see cars driving at night time with one tail light going on and off as they brake - same problem |
